What are Downpipes?
Downpipes, likewise called rainwater pipes or vertical pipelines, are set up as part of a structure's drainage system. They gather rainwater from roof gutters and transport it downwards to designated drainage areas, such as storm drains. Downpipes can be made from different materials, consisting of:

- P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ride)
- Metal (aluminum, galvanized steel, copper)
- Cast iron
- Concrete
Table 1: Pros and Cons of Different Downpipe Materials
Material | Pros | Cons |
---|---|---|
PVC | Light-weight, cost-efficient, corrosion-resistant | Can warp in severe heat |
Metal | Durable, aesthetic appeal, recyclable | Prone to rust if not appropriately treated |
Cast Iron | Very resilient, fire-resistant | Heavy, pricey, needs maintenance |
Concrete | Extremely resilient, great for large volumes | Heavy, more tough to set up |
Value of Downpipes
The significance of appropriate downpipe installations can not be overemphasized. They add to a number of important practical and aesthetic advantages, including:
Preventing Water Damage: Downpipes guarantee that rainwater is successfully transported away, reducing the danger of moisture and rot in the structure and walls.
Erosion Control: By directing rains into approved drainage systems, downpipes assist protect the surrounding landscape from soil erosion.
Protecting Landscaping: Properly set up downpipes can help channel water far from flower beds, gardens, and lawns, preserving the looks and health of your outside area.
Building Longevity: With reliable drainage systems in place, downpipes aid extend the lifespan of your building by decreasing the wear and tear triggered by incorrect water management.

Frequently Asked Questions about Downpipes
What is the typical cost of downpipe installation?
The cost of downpipe installation can differ commonly based on the material utilized and the complexity of the installation. On average, property owners can an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 500 to ₤ 1,500.
How frequently should downpipes be kept?
Routine maintenance is important. It's suggested to have actually downpipes examined a minimum of when a year, particularly after heavy rainfall, to look for blockages or damage.
Can I install downpipes myself?
While some house owners with DIY experience may choose self-installation, it's frequently best to hire professionals. Incorrect installation can lead to drainage problems and increased repair costs.
How do I know if my downpipes require to be replaced?
Indications your downpipes might require replacement consist of visible rust or damage, leaks, and ineffective drainage resulting in water pooling around the structure.
Exist constructing codes for downpipes?
Yes, lots of towns have specific structure codes relating to the installation of Downpipes Near Me. It's vital to examine local policies to make sure compliance.
